But what exactly are solar panels, and how do they work? Simply put, solar panels are devices that convert sunlight into electricity. Made up of photovoltaic (PV) cells, these panels absorb the sun’s rays and use them to generate DC power, which is then converted into AC power that can be used to power homes, businesses, and even entire communities.

One of the most significant advantages of solar panels is their environmental impact. By harnessing the sun’s energy, we can significantly reduce our reliance on fossil fuels and lower greenhouse gas emissions. In fact, studies have shown that widespread adoption of solar energy could account for up to 20% of the world’s electricity generation by 2030.

But solar panels aren’t just great for the planet – they’re also a smart investment. The cost of solar panels has plummeted in recent years, making them a more affordable option for homeowners and businesses. In fact, the average cost of a solar panel system has fallen by over 70% in the last decade alone. And with many governments offering incentives and tax credits for solar installations, the financial benefits of going solar are clear.

Of course, one of the biggest concerns people have about solar panels is their efficiency. While it’s true that solar panels don’t work as well on cloudy days or during the winter months, modern technology has made significant strides in addressing these issues. Some solar panels now boast efficiencies of up to 22%, and new innovations like bifacial panels and smart inverters are helping to optimize energy production.

Another benefit of solar panels is their durability. While they’re not invincible, high-quality solar panels can last for 25 years or more, providing a steady stream of clean energy for homes and businesses. And with many manufacturers now offering warranties of up to 30 years, the risk of degradation or failure is minimal.
